In my experience with this, HTML text formatting is retained if the signature is copied either from an email you're composing (e.g. sending yourself an email containing your signature and then hitting either Reply or Forward to open up a Compose window) or from an email you're just viewing (i.e. copying the signature before hitting Reply or Forward)...but I can't remember which one.

Whichever way I first did it resulted in the color of the text reverting to black but the 2nd way I did it has worked.

Oh and, in addition to dark blue, italicized text, my company requires us to have an image as part of our email signature (the whole thing doesn't actually look as bad as it might sound) which, as others have mentioned, seems to disappear after a short while.

EDIT: just tested this and formatting is retained when the signature is copied from within a Compose window.
